A salesperson tries to recruit new customers. The salesperson estimates that the probability of recruiting a new customer is 0.3. During January he will try to recruit 100 new customers. The salesperson receives a wage of $1,000 and bonus of $100 for each new customer he is able to recruit.

  1. Find the expected salary of the salesperson during January.

  2. Find the variance of the salary of the salesperson.
